Noah Mackey

I absolutely adore this place. I’m 38, from here, and somehow hadn’t been until last year. Holy wow I can’t believe I waited this long. How silly of me. This place rules.

So laid back. So well thought out. So reasonably priced. So friendly. Great for groups or solo.

Great selection of concessions. You’re allowed to bring your own food but yo, support them. Buy their stuff. It’s way cheaper than normal theaters. Way more variety too.

Four screens that always show two or three movies, and they don’t care if you mix and match (switch to another screen after the first movie). Always one price. $12, and if they raise it, fair enough. Tons of space. The worst thing you’ll encounter is some mildly unruly high school kids, but the staff will come thru on a golf cart if they’re too wild.

Mostly it’s super chill.

Speaking of the golf cart, it will also show up if someone has their headlights on for more than a minute or two but get this, they’re SUPER nice about it and if you can’t figure out how to have sound and make your lights be off (some cars are weird) they carry these opaque panels of material that they will tape over your lights for you. Frickin awesome. They will also jump your car if your battery dies. Smart.

This is just a business done right. Whoever makes the rules gives a hoot about movies and drive-ins and the whole experience of it all.

This is such a great way to enjoy a movie. I guess you don’t get the crazy sound system that modern theaters have, and planes fly over a fair bit as it’s not too far from the airport, but the picture is amazing and the trade off is well worth it. So much more relaxed than a normal theater.

Honestly one of my only complaints is that it’s so pleasant, I tend to have an overly positive bias about the movies I see here. If I saw it at Tibbs, I liked it. So maybe avoid if you’re a critic and need to write harshly about film.

So if you have heard about Tubns your whole life but never been, do it.

Long live The Tibbs!

Austin Steenman

Basically no bad seats in the theater, sat far left (C31) and still had a great view of everything, but I can imagine the front two rows might get some strain looking up the whole time. Seats were comfy and most recline slightly, but there is very little leg room for people over 6ft or in situations where people might need to shuffle past. Films generally have no trailers and only minimal State Museum ad clips before starting, our 4:30pm film started only about 10 minutes after posted time. Concessions are the right size considering there’s only one screen, but gets backed up when everyone shows up 10 minutes before start time so show up earlier if you want popcorn.

This theatre opened July 26, 1967, across the parking lot of the Glendale Shopping Center Mall. The theatre, as most General Cinema theatres were not designed to win awards for decor. Pretty plain. Circa 1970, the Glendale 3 & 4 opened across the street on North Keystone.

The largest screen was eventually divided into tunnel vision theatres (long and narrow). Today Kerasotes Theatres has a megaplex at the Glendale Mall location.

    Frequently asked questions about cinemas in Indianapolis

    What should I expect when visiting a cinema in Indianapolis?

    When you arrive at a cinema in Indianapolis, you’ll typically encounter a box office or ticketing desk where you can purchase or pick up pre-purchased tickets. Many venues also offer online pre-purchase and mobile tickets. Inside, there will be a concessions counter with popcorn, drinks, and snacks, and seating in the auditorium with varying layouts, including general admission or assigned seating depending on the venue.

    How do ticket prices typically work in Indianapolis cinemas?

    Ticket prices can vary by location, time of day, and format. Expect a matinee price for earlier showings and a higher rate for peak times. Many cinemas offer discounts for students, seniors, military personnel, or special loyalty programs. Some venues also feature discount days or bundle deals for concessions.

    Are there dine-in or luxury seating options available?

    Some cinemas provide premium seating such as reclining seats or reserved seating to enhance comfort. A few venues offer dining experiences or café-style spaces where guests can enjoy meals before or during a screening. Availability varies by location, so it’s helpful to check the specific theater’s offerings in advance.

    What accessibility options exist for guests with disabilities?

    Many Indianapolis cinemas provide accessible seating in multiple areas, wheelchair access, and assistive listening devices. Screenings may include captioned screenings and audio description for patrons who need additional accessibility features. It’s wise to contact the venue beforehand to confirm available accommodations and seating arrangements.

    How does parking work near downtown Indianapolis cinemas?

    Parking options typically include on-street metered parking, nearby public garages, and private lots. Some cinemas offer validated parking for certain purchases or programs. If you plan to drive, consider parking validation policies and the walking distance to the theater, or explore convenient public transit routes.

    Do cinemas in Indianapolis offer special screenings or events?

    Indianapolis venues frequently host special screenings, including indie premieres, film festivals, and genre nights. Some cinemas also present theme evenings, Q&A sessions with filmmakers, or local film showcases that celebrate community cinema.

    What safety measures are common in theaters?

    Most theaters maintain a focus on cleaning protocols, air filtration, and prudent sanitation of common surfaces. Seating may be arranged to manage capacity, and staff can assist with crowd flow and safety guidance. If you have concerns, you can contact the theater in advance to learn about their current policies.

    Can I reserve seats in advance, and how?

    Yes, many cinemas allow online booking through their website or mobile app, with a visual seat map to choose your spot. You can often also place phone reservations or purchase tickets at the box office. Check each venue’s policy on refunds or exchanges in case plans change.

    How do I find a cinema with the best showtimes near me?

    You can locate the best showtimes by visiting each theater’s official site, using a mobile app, or consulting local listings. Some apps aggregate showtimes from multiple cinemas, helping you compare distance and availability to pick a convenient option.

    Are there differences between indie cinemas and large chains in Indianapolis?

    Indie cinemas often emphasize indie and arthouse films, local programming, and a more intimate atmosphere, with events and conversations that reflect the community. Large chains typically show a wider slate of Mainstream releases, more screens, and broader loyalty programs, offering predictable schedules and conveniences for families and general audiences.
